Transaction 83708cefc537eb71006a2b01c7dcbf70b9848aa86fe14cdc4e3c9420bac106a1

1 Input
2 Outputs
  • 83708cefc537eb71006a2b01c7dcbf70b9848aa86fe14cdc4e3c9420bac106a1:0
  • value  1060000
    address  3CRFqzBvhe8cPPQxoCZrzvhiDZABKB9ehC
  • 83708cefc537eb71006a2b01c7dcbf70b9848aa86fe14cdc4e3c9420bac106a1:1
  • value  13111915
    address  32HHxfhECi5e5SPc6Rxe5uL4gXSK3GQXnn